Bug description:
  I have a keyboard that doesn't have multimedia keys to control the
  volume.  I use the machine for development so I mapped an obscure key
  combination to control the volume up/down.  These keyboard shortcuts
  worked with gutsy and hardy.  I recently upgraded to interpid and it
  no longer works.

  I remapped the shortcuts to use ctrl-up/ctrl-down instead as a short
  term fix.  I'm not sure why they suddenly stopped working.
